Shockwave Therapy

Shockwave therapy is a non-surgical treatment that delivers short bursts of high-intensity mechanical energy in the form of acoustic shockwaves to injured, scarred, painful, or inflamed soft tissues. Initially used for breaking up kidney stones (lithotripsy) in the early 1980s, its application has expanded to effectively manage a wide range of musculoskeletal conditions. It is also sometimes referred to as extracorporeal pulse activation technology (EPAT).

How Does Shockwave Therapy Work?

These powerful yet safe acoustic waves trigger biological responses that promote healing and pain relief. The effects of shockwave therapy include:

  • Stimulating the body’s natural healing process.
  • Increasing local blood flow and metabolism in the treated area helps promote tissue repair, especially in poorly vascularized tissues like tendons.
  • Enhancing collagen synthesis and stimulating fibroblast proliferation are essential for rebuilding damaged connective tissues like tendons and ligaments.
  • Breaking down scar tissue and adhesions that can restrict movement and cause pain.
  • Reducing inflammation by increasing mast cells and promoting the release of anti-inflammatory cytokines.
  • Decreasing pain through mechanisms like hyperstimulation analgesia (overwhelming local nerve endings) and the gate-control mechanism (modulating pain perception).
  • Potentially dissolving calcific deposits embedded in damaged tissue.
  • Stimulating osteoblasts, cells responsible for bone healing and new bone production, which is beneficial for conditions like stress fractures and non-unions.
  • Releasing trigger points in muscles by unblocking calcium pumps.
  • Increasing cell membrane permeability and microscopic circulation.
  • Promoting the release of growth factors in the injured tissue.
  • Delivering a mechanical force to body tissues, promoting regrowth and healing of tissue and bone.

Conditions We Treat with Shockwave Therapy for Pain

Shockwave therapy has demonstrated significant efficacy in treating a wide array of chronic musculoskeletal conditions causing pain. Our team utilizes ESWT to address pain associated with:

  • Foot Pain:
    • Plantar Fasciitis
    • Achilles Tendinopathy (including mid-portion and insertional)
    • Heel Pain
    • Retrocalcaneal Bursitis
    • Morton’s Neuroma
    • Tendonitis in the foot and ankle
    • Nerve impingement or ligament injury in the foot
  • Ankle Pain:
    • Chronic ankle pain (including osteoarthritis and ligamentous instability)
    • Ligamentous defect in the ankle
    • Gastrocnemius muscle strain or injury
  • Lower Leg Pain:
    • Medial Tibial Stress Syndrome (Shin Splints)
  • Knee Pain:
    • Patellar Tendinopathy (Jumper’s Knee)
    • Knee Osteoarthritis
    • IT Band Syndrome
    • Insertional pain around the knee
    • Strain to the medial or lateral collateral ligaments
  • Upper Leg Pain:
    • Hamstring Injuries/Tendinopathy
    • Quadriceps Injury
    • “Bursitis” or tendinopathy in the hip
    • Gluteal muscle strain/tendinopathy
    • Iliopsoas bursitis/Hip flexor tendinosis
    • Greater Trochanteric Pain Syndrome
  • Elbow Pain:
    • Lateral Epicondylosis (Tennis Elbow)
    • Medial Epicondylosis (Golfer’s Elbow)
    • Little League Elbow
    • Triceps or biceps elbow injuries
  • Shoulder Pain:
    • Rotator Cuff Injuries/Tendinopathy (including partial tears and calcinosis)
    • Frozen Shoulder
    • Biceps Injuries
  • Hand Pain:
    • Strains and injuries in the hand
  • Bone Conditions:
    • Stress Fractures (Delayed Healing)
    • Fracture Nonunion (broken bones that haven’t healed)
    • Avascular Necrosis of the Femoral Head
  • Other:
    • Myofascial Trigger Points in Muscle
    • Spasticity related to neurological conditions such as stroke, cerebral palsy, spinal cord injury, and multiple sclerosis

What to Expect During Your Shockwave Therapy

Initial Assessment:

  • We will conduct a thorough evaluation to understand your pain, medical history, and the specific condition affecting you. This may include a physical examination and review of any relevant imaging (though imaging is not always required to begin ESWT).
  • We will explain the principles of shockwave therapy, discuss the potential benefits and risks, and answer any questions you may have.
  • Together, we will determine if shockwave therapy is the right treatment option for you. We will also consider any potential contraindications (see below).

The Treatment Procedure:

  • You will be positioned comfortably to allow access to the treatment area.
  • A water-based gel will be applied to your skin to facilitate the transmission of the shockwaves.
  • Our clinician will use a handheld applicator to deliver the shockwaves to the targeted area.
  • You will typically feel fast pulses, and some patients may experience mild discomfort during the treatment, often described as a “little jackhammer” or a “deep tissue massage”.
  • The intensity of the therapy can be adjusted based on your comfort level. We aim for a level of discomfort that is tolerable and therapeutic.
  • Treatments are typically short, lasting only about 5 to 20 minutes per session.

Number of Treatments:

  • Most patients see long-term results after only 2 to 5 treatments, which are usually administered once a week. However, the exact number of sessions will depend on your specific condition and how you respond to the therapy.
  • For bone-related conditions and spasticity, treatments may be spaced at 1-week intervals.
  • We will continuously monitor your progress and adjust your treatment plan as needed.

After Your Treatment:

  • It is not uncommon to feel a bit sore in the treated area afterward, and some mild bruising or redness may occur. This is usually temporary.
  • We generally advise you to avoid anti-inflammatory medications (NSAIDs), ice, fluoroquinolones, and corticosteroids as they may interfere with the natural healing process stimulated by ESWT. Acetaminophen (Tylenol) can be used for pain relief if needed.
  • You can usually return to your normal activities almost immediately, often within 24 hours. However, we may recommend modifying activities based on your condition, particularly for bone pathologies.
  • It’s important to follow any specific post-treatment instructions provided by your therapist or chiropractor, which may include guidance on activity levels and combining ESWT with physical therapy exercises to restore tissue function and optimize treatment response.
  • While some patients experience immediate pain relief, the full benefits of shockwave therapy often develop over time as the injured tissues heal.


Shockwave therapy is generally considered a safe and well-tolerated procedure when performed by a qualified practitioner. Common side effects are typically mild and localized and may include:

    • Pain at the applicator site.
    • Skin redness (erythema).
    • Skin bruising.
